To be recognized as a provider of relevant professional education to your colleagues:

 

  1. Be familiar with the curriculum so you understand the needs of the different departments.
  2. Find out who the person(s) responsible for district professional development is and
  3. Offer to talk to the staff about the resources available, how to integrate the available technological resources into lesson planning, how to design projects that promote the development of critical thinking, problem solving and decision making skills through inquiry and research, ways to promote an appreciation of reading, etc.
  4. Be a member of the district professional development committee if possible.
  5. When you present workshops, collect evaluations from attendees that you can use to improve your presentations and provide testimonials if needed.
